Student-Athlete Q&A
What made Liberty University the right place for you to attend college/compete at the collegiate level?
Liberty was the only school that recruited me really hard and showed that they wanted me.
Who in your life inspires you and why are they such an inspiration?
My mother inspires me because she worked so hard to raise me as a single mother.

- Saw playing time in five games before being sidelined with an illness
- Started his final game of the season against FIU
- Finished the season with 13 tackles (eight solo, five assisted)
- Added 2.5 tackles for a loss (four yards) and 1.0 sacks (three yards)
- Also add two quarterbacks hurries, a forced fumble and a pass breakup
- Recorded Liberty’s longest interception of the season with a 43-yard return against UTEP
- Also added a tackle and a quarterback hurry against UTEP
- An assisted tackle, quarterback hurry and a pass breakup against New Mexico State
- Posted four solo stops against East Carolina, including a tackle for a loss
- Recorded a season-high seven tackles against FIU, including a three-yard sack and a forced fumble

- Graduated from Bloomington Senior High School in Valrico, Fla.
- Helped Bloomington playoff semifinals as a sophomore, finishing the year with a 13-1 record
- Recorded six tackles and a pass breakup as a sophomore
- First-team defensive back as a junior
- Finished his junior season with 51 tackles, including 44 solo stops
- Added four interceptions and seven pass deflections as a junior
- First-team all-purpose player as a senior
- Finished his senior year with 45 tackles
- Also added 800 rushing yards and 12 touchdowns as a senior
- Also participated in track
- Son of Christina Bodnar
- Uncle, Mohamed Sanu, was an all-conference wide receiver at Rutgers (2009-11)
- Sanu was a third-round NFL Draft pick by Cincinnati Bengals in 2012
- Sanu played in the NFL for 2012-22 for Cincinnati, Atlanta, New England, San Francisco, Detroit and Miami
